29 CFR 4003.7: Exhaustion of administrative remedies.

Except as provided in § 4003.22(b), a person aggrieved by an initial determination of PBGC covered by this part, other than an initial determination subject to reconsideration that is issued by a Department Director, has not exhausted his or her administrative remedies until he or she has filed a request for reconsideration under subpart C of this part or an appeal under subpart D of this part, whichever is applicable, and a decision granting or denying the relief requested has been issued.
